Positive enforcement at LHR T5 this evening
I wrong footed myself by joining the very much shorter general boarding line this evening. As it happened staff were not only enforcing the fast track lane but also held back general boarding until the very last passenger cleared the fast track channel. That person happened to be me - I switched lane after I'd cottoned on to what was happening.
Anyway, by my rough calculation about 60% of passengers who boarded tonight's 1494 did so via the fast track channel.
